This oil painting, titled "The Artist's Studio," is a masterpiece by the renowned French Realist painter, Gustave Courbet. Created between 1854 and 1855, this artwork is a testament to Courbet's innovative approach to representing the world around him with unflinching honesty and raw emotion. The large-scale canvas, measuring approximately 162.4 x 228.6 cm, invites viewers to step inside the artist's studio and witness the creative process unfold. Courbet himself is depicted in the center, seated confidently at his easel, lost in thought as he contemplates his work. Surrounding him are various models, nudes, and other objects, all arranged haphazardly, reflecting the chaotic and unapologetic nature of the artistic process. The use of rich, vibrant colors and bold brushstrokes adds to the painting's sense of energy and vitality. The horizontal composition and the focus on the interior scene further emphasize the intimacy and immediacy of the moment. This painting is a significant work in the history of Western art, marking a departure from traditional artistic conventions and paving the way for modern artistic movements. It is currently housed in the Musée d'Orsay in Paris, France, where it continues to captivate and inspire visitors from around the world.
